Package io.ebeaninternal.server.type
Class DataEncryptSupport
- java.lang.Object
-
- io.ebeaninternal.server.type.DataEncryptSupport
-
public class DataEncryptSupport extends Object
-
-
Constructor Summary
Constructors Constructor Description DataEncryptSupport(EncryptKeyManager encryptKeyManager, Encryptor encryptor, String table, String column)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description byte[]
decrypt(byte[] data)
String
decryptObject(byte[] data)
byte[]
encrypt(byte[] data)
byte[]
encryptObject(String formattedValue)
-
-
-
Constructor Detail
-
DataEncryptSupport
public DataEncryptSupport(EncryptKeyManager encryptKeyManager, Encryptor encryptor, String table, String column)
-
-
Method Detail
-
encrypt
public byte[] encrypt(byte[] data)
-
decrypt
public byte[] decrypt(byte[] data)
-
decryptObject
public String decryptObject(byte[] data)
-
encryptObject
public byte[] encryptObject(String formattedValue)
-
-